Department of Music presents men’s and women’s fall concert
The Ohio Northern University Men’s and Women’s Choruses will perform their fall concert in the Snyder Recital Hall of Presser Hall on Friday, Nov. 13, at 8 p.m. The concert is free and open to the public.
The ONU Men’s Chorus, directed by Dr. Ben Ayling, will perform a varied selection of pieces, including “Loch Lomond,” “How Great Thou Art,” “Mary Had a Baby” and the traditional Pennsylvania Dutch tune “Johnnie Schmoker.”
The ONU Women’s Chorus, made up of more than 60 women, will present selections by Linda Spevacek, Eleanor Daley, Eric Whitacre and Z. Randall Stroope. Additionally, they will present a piece with poetry based on a parlor game played by Jane Austen, her sister Cassandra, and her mother. The Women’s Chorus is conducted by Marilyn Roth Basinger, now in her fourth year leading the ONU Women’s Chorus.
